Physical Education and Health Teacher K-5
Position: Physical Education Teacher (K-5) and Health (3-5)
Wildwood School is an urban, coed, college-preparatory, K-12 school in West Los Angeles recognized for its innovative practices, progressive pedagogy, and commitment to diversity, equity, inclusion, and belonging. The school enrolls 728 students in three divisions on two campuses. Wildwood School's deep commitment to ongoing professional development feeds a renowned Outreach Center that has provided programming for public and independent school teachers, administrators, and trustees in over 16 states and eight countries. Wildwood School is also a founding member of the Mastery Transcript Consortium.

Primary responsibilities include but are not limited to the following:
  • Educate students in developing an understanding of the human body, healthy lifestyle, motor skills and movement knowledge, social and personal skills.
  • Teach a health curriculum that focuses on physical health, mental/emotional health, and social health.
  • Building positive relationships with colleagues through regular meetings and communication.
  • Assisting students in developing and maintaining acceptable levels of physical fitness.
  • Supporting daily lesson activities by demonstrating skills, supervising students, providing equipment, and evaluating performance.
  • Teaching students a variety of basic movement and manipulative skills necessary for physical activities.
  • Promoting positive interactions and teamwork in a movement environment.
  • Providing students with information and skills applicable to everyday living.
  • Encouraging students to embrace and pursue a healthy lifestyle.
  • Implementing an effective behavior management program consistent with other P.E. teachers.
  • Evaluating student progress and writing assessments
  • Ensuring instructional materials and equipment are readily available for lessons.
  • Assisting with morning and afternoon student supervision, drop-off, and pick-up duties.
  • Maintaining confidentiality guidelines related to students, parents, and Physical Education and Health activities.
